Summary:





The Pharmacy Technician assists pharmacists in preparing and distributing medication, and maintaining patient records. The Pharmacy Technician works only under the supervision of a Registered Pharmacist. The Pharmacy Technician does not perform duties that can legally be performed only be a Registered Pharmacist.

Responsibilities:





1. Fills patient-medication cart with unit doses of medications according to patient profiles and with attention to patient ages.


2. Prepares unit doses of medications for verification by pharmacist prior to dispensing.


3. Re-packages bulk oral solid and liquid medications into unit-dose containers.


4. Makes daily rounds to patient care areas to inventory floor-stock medications and supplies.Reconciles stock levels with patient charges.


5. Replaces medications and supplies in automated dispensing system according to dispensing records.Reconciles stock levels with patient charge information.


6. Files floor-stock sheets daily.


7. Answers telephone, receiving and relaying messages accurately and as needed.


8. Accurately enters daily patient charges using information from charge sheets.


9. Inspects medication storage areas monthly as assigned.


10. Places, receives and stocks orders with wholesaler and other vendors as required.


11. Maintains medication and supply inventories.


12. Organizes expired or overstocked medications for return to appropriate vendors.


13. Generates reports, picks lists, and labels as required.


14. Answers requests at the window and makes stat deliveries to patient care areas when requested.


15. Replenishes medications in emergency crash carts or floor stock areas accurately.


16. Acquires current home med list of admitted patients by using resources available including patient/family interview, HCS medication query, patient's pharmacy or patient's physician.Enters Home Med List into HCS for Pharmacist review and reconciliation.
